首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

限制kubernetes里的系统资源使用

工作中需要对kubernetes中workload使用的系统资源进行一些限制,本周花时间研究了一下,这里记录一下。...kubernetes的系统资源限制机制 kuberentes里存在两种机制进行系统资源限制,一个是Resource Quotas,一个是Limit Ranges。...Resource Quotas 使用Resource Quotas可以限制某个命名空间使用的系统资源,使用方法如下: kubectl create namespace quota-object-example...另外还可以给不同的scope指定不同的系统资源限制,如下: cat << EOF | kubectl -n quota-object-example create -f - apiVersion: v1...Limit Ranges 除了限制整个命名空间的系统资源使用量外,还可以通过Limit Ranges限制容器或pod的系统资源使用量,如下: kubectl create namespace limitrange-demo

1.2K20

操作系统资源管理技术

由于物理资源有限,而竞争资源的应用程序过多,必须很好地解决物理资源数量不足的和合理分配资源这两个问题。要实现资源的易用性,只能借助系统所提供的功能或者其他设施来控制与使用。...这里将结合所学的三种操作系统资源管理技术:复用、虚拟和抽象来探讨一下。 资源复用 什么叫资源复用呢?...通过适当复用可以创建虚拟资源和虚拟机,以解决物理资源数量不足问题。物理资源的复用共享有两种基本方法:空分复用共享和时分复用共享。...采用虚拟技术不仅可以解决物理资源数量不足的问题,而且能够为应用程序提供易于使用的虚拟资源并创建更好的运行环境。...在操作系统的设计、实现和使用中自始至终贯穿这些技术的应用,采用这些资源管理技术的目标之一是解决物理资源数量不足和资源易用性的问题。好了,此次博客到此结束,同学们下次再会!

78800

第十三章 系统资源管理

第十三章 系统资源管理 13.1 系统配置查看 我们日常经常会提及系统资源的使用状况,那么系统资源具体是指什么呢?...其实系统资源主要分为两种,运行资源和存储资源 运行资源:又称计算资源,主要是cpu、内存资源。 存储资源:即文件系统资源。...分析一下表中数据,当CPU使用LV到达警告值时,即cpu使用率60%以上(空闲率%idle不足40%),此时一般会有两种可能: 一种是cpu的%user超50%,代表本机上的应用程序、服务程序占据较多cpu...13.9 查看系统资源的访问关系 另外,我们还可以查看系统中的各个进程、用户、文件、设备之间的访问关系,即谁正在访问谁,命令如下 lsof ---查看正在被进程访问的设备、文件,会显示设备、进程

98820
领券